Apply for British Passport

Post by Yazzy » Tue Aug 27, 2024 5:59 pm

Hi my husband has a private citizenship ceremony scheduled for 4th Sep. i was hoping if someone can clarify when my husband can exactly apply for his British passport after the ceremony? Google is telling me we have to wait 48 hours. Is this correct? Or can we apply straight after the ceremony?
Also how many referees do we need for the passport?

Re: Apply for British Passport

Post by alterhase58 » Tue Aug 27, 2024 6:02 pm

Why do you google this? There’s a load of junk info on the web.

You can apply the minute you have your certificate, if you are well organised.

One referee only, must be professional and British citizen with passport.
